WebJan 7, 2024 · The opposite of teacher thriving is teacher burnout, which has become a pressing national concern. Teachers leaving the profession has increased by a third in the past decade. In addition, the pipeline of teachers is shrinking; 27% fewer education degrees were awarded in 2016 compared to 2008. WebCauses of Teacher Burnout. WebJan 23, 2024 · A study of 121 teachers and 1,817 students (kindergarten to fourth grade) identified four patterns of teacher adjustment to stress, coping, efficacy, and burnout. High levels of stress were found in three of the four classes, which were described as high coping/low burnout (60%), moderate coping and burnout (30%), and low coping/high …
